Transaction 50cee788c5010b7edd6394ddc718212dad482016ecb2ddd4fdec0a2d27ead908

95 Input
2 Outputs
  • 50cee788c5010b7edd6394ddc718212dad482016ecb2ddd4fdec0a2d27ead908:0
  • value  1000000000
    address  3H7GC9GCrfzYD3Doua3CSseLaDF7MStmvv
  • 50cee788c5010b7edd6394ddc718212dad482016ecb2ddd4fdec0a2d27ead908:1
  • value  1029662
    address  159Xx6oF8aspyRWzq9KYkjNSMhAmXjDvhn